According to Bits media, analysis data from Russian IT security company Shard shows that over the past year, Russian users lost a total of 234 million rubles (approximately $3.25 million) to cryptocurrency phishing scams, accounting for 62% of all known crypto asset losses. The data reveals that the total amount of cryptocurrency theft reported by users in the country last year was 378.5 million rubles, with illegal investment services causing losses of 49.2 million rubles. Analysts pointed out that fraudsters mainly use fake trading websites, malicious wallet apps, and forged AML compliance check smart contracts to steal private keys. Since the statistics only include known cases, the actual losses may be even higher. https://www.(wublock123.com)/news/news-61719
